想卷编程的大学生如何利用寒假提升自己?该学什么?要不要去实习?

简介: 想卷编程的大学生如何利用寒假提升自己?该学什么?要不要去实习?

想卷编程的大学生如何利用寒假提升自己?该学什么?要不要去实习?

提供面试辅导服务、试用期辅导服务、自学辅导服务

免费修改前端简历,免费回答小问题

关注程序员耳东,编程转码真轻松

好久没发笔记了,并不是东哥飘了,而是东哥最近阳了,这两天刚退了烧,希望大家都做好防护,阳了是真的难受

这篇笔记聊聊如何利用寒假把自己的编程能力卷上去,因为大家都知道其实现在找工作是比较难的,所以要提前开始卷,早做准备总是没错的

下面我就从寒假要不要实习、寒假如何提升自己两个方向去行文

首先说要不要寒假去实习,我个人觉得没必要哈,首先寒假时间太短了,不到1个月的时间,还有过年的时间,这么短的时间没有公司会要的,而且就算要了,你去实习不到1个月就跑路,也学不到什么东西

如果你真的有找到实习的能力,那你放心,你在家再好好准备准备,过完年肯定能找到比现在还好的实习,毕竟都说金三银四,过完年的工作机会是真的比年底多很多

再或者说,如果你没有找到实习的能力,只是焦虑,那我觉得你大可不必,寒假到明年4月,还有时间可以让你卷

然后再说说寒假如何提升自己,寒假就短短1个月,我建议你就别面面俱到了,一定要相信贪多嚼不烂,计划的越多完成的越少,抓住自己最需要补习的短板去做练习就好了

那么东哥推荐你从下面这几件事中根据自身情况选1个事情来做就好了,千万别都想做,你没时间的

补习数据结构

如果你数据结构很差很差,那我建议你可以在假期就聚焦到补习数据结构上面,为啥呢?

因为之前我写过的笔记也说了,数据结构不论是在面试还是程序设计优化代码方面都是非常重要的,所以假期有时间一定要把它重点补习

这里分几种情况,我分别来推荐做法

如果你的基础很差,差到相当于没学数据结构一样,那我推荐你假期把清华大学邓俊辉老师的数据结构课程跟完,这个课程是一门数据结构的公开课,讲的很好,课程语言用的是C++,非常适合数据结构差的同学在假期自学

如果你的基础还可以,但是想在假期继续提高,那我建议你直接开始做题,可以去做力扣的热题 HOT 100,这个题集是精选100道力扣(LeetCode)上最热门的题目,适合初识算法与数据结构的新手和想要在短时间内高效提升的人,把这些题目弄完,数据结构算法能力肯定是上升一个台阶

做1个小项目

粉丝里面问我比较多的一个问题就是项目实战的问题,经常有人说自己没有项目经验,毕业了找工作了发现简历上没啥可写的,又或者是好不容易混过了面试,找到了一份工作,但是上班了之后发现实战能力太差,对需求的理解和程序设计能力都不太好

那么在假期的时候就可以抓住机会来做一个小项目,就拿最简单最经典的todolist来说,你可以试着从0开始做一个

如果时间充足的话,可以试着把整个项目的前端、后端部分都做出来,我相信这个项目做完,你的编程能力肯定会提升不少,而且以后你学习了新的技术,还可以把这个项目使用新技术重构一遍,它就成为了你的练兵场

练习英语

为啥要把练习英语这件事情单拎出来说呢,因为编程届的很多优质资料都是英文版的,如果你英文不好那学习编程就多了很多阻力

面向编程的练习英语,我们只需要练习阅读能力就好了,因为我们更偏向于读英文的文档和资料

你可以注册一个GitHub的账号和Medium的账号,坚持每天去上面看它的技术文章,每天看一篇,不懂的单词就查,等你坚持完假期,可能你以后找学习资料都是第一优先级选择英文的资料,学习编程也会更快

相关文章
|
数据采集 机器学习/深度学习 资源调度
归一化和标准化
归一化和标准化
|
SQL 存储 关系型数据库
【MySQL学习笔记】系列三:演示使用MySQL、介绍图形化管理工具、MySQL的目录结构与源码(二)
【MySQL学习笔记】系列三:演示使用MySQL、介绍图形化管理工具、MySQL的目录结构与源码(二)
|
8月前
|
计算机视觉
YOLOv11改进策略【Neck】| PRCV 2023,SBA(Selective Boundary Aggregation):特征融合模块,描绘物体轮廓重新校准物体位置,解决边界模糊问题
YOLOv11改进策略【Neck】| PRCV 2023,SBA(Selective Boundary Aggregation):特征融合模块,描绘物体轮廓重新校准物体位置,解决边界模糊问题
320 11
|
9月前
|
前端开发 容器
CSS 居中技术完全指南:从基础到高级应用
本文详细介绍了 CSS 中常用的居中方法,涵盖水平居中、垂直居中及同时实现两者的方法。
308 12
|
域名解析 Web App开发 存储
DNS域名解析详解
DNS(Domain Name System,域名系统)是互联网中一种用于将域名解析为IP地址的分布式命名系统。它负责将人类可读的域名(如:www.example.com)转换为计算机可识别的IP地址(如:192.168.1.1),以便浏览器能够连接到相应的服务器并获取网页内容。本文主要简单说说关于DNS域名解析的一些常用知识,包括概念,域名的层级结构,域名服务器,DNS的查询方式等等。
1756 2
|
12月前
|
安全 Java Go
Go语言有哪些优势
【10月更文挑战第10天】Go语言有哪些优势
281 0
|
文字识别 自然语言处理 C#
印刷文字识别使用问题之C#发票识别的代码实例在哪里可以查看
印刷文字识别产品,通常称为OCR(Optical Character Recognition)技术,是一种将图像中的印刷或手写文字转换为机器编码文本的过程。这项技术广泛应用于多个行业和场景中,显著提升文档处理、信息提取和数据录入的效率。以下是印刷文字识别产品的一些典型使用合集。
|
JavaScript 前端开发 测试技术
解锁弹框:Python 下的 Playwright 弹框处理完全指南
本文介绍了如何使用Python的Playwright库处理Web自动化测试中的弹框。弹框分为alert、confirm和prompt三种类型。在Playwright中,可通过`page.on('dialog')`事件监听器进行处理。对于警告框,定义`on_dialog`函数打印消息并接受弹框;确认框可使用`dialog.accept()`或`dialog.dismiss()`;提示框则使用`dialog.accept(text)`输入文本。Playwright的API简化了弹框处理,提升了自动化测试效率。
|
弹性计算 大数据 测试技术
阿里云服务器多少钱一年?2024年阿里云服务器价格表新鲜出炉
阿里云服务器分为轻量应用服务器和云服务器ECS,轻量适合个人开发者使用,搭建轻量级的网站、测试环境使用,专业级如大数据、科学计算、高并发网站等需要使用云服务器ECS,以下是分享阿里云服务器租用费用,也可以移步到官方服务器页面:云服务器ECS经济型e实例2核2G、3M固定带宽99元一年、ECS u1实例2核4G、5M固定带宽、80G ESSD Entry盘优惠价格199元一年,轻量应用服务器2核2G3M带宽轻量服务器一年61元、2核4G4M带宽轻量服务器一年165元12个月、2核4G服务器30元3个月